Regal adjective - Large and impressive in size, grandeur, extent, or conception.
Usage example: envisioned a regal wedding with hundreds of guests, a full choir, and a reception at the fanciest hotel in town
Striking and regal are semantically related. in majestic topic. In some cases you can use "Striking" instead an adjective "Regal".
